I have a Tar River 6' drum and run it on a Ford 3910 with no wheel weights and no fluid in the tires. Up front is a Ford OEM grille guard.
I went to a used implement dealer and scrounged around his used weights looking for the cheapest. I found some in the $20 each category and using all thread, mounted 8 of them on that front guard. More than enough counterweight. I pumped my right rear tire to the full rated 18# which helped too, not the ride, the tractor stability. I also took the bar off the top that goes out over the outer drum and installed a 36 x 2 hydraulic cylinder I had lying around and a couple of home made adapters. Works great in getting rid of some of the feet in the foot-pounds equation and helps to navigate without the tip dragging.
